Follicles
Small secretory cavities or glands, especially those in the skin that produce hair, or in the ovaries that release eggs.
Progesterone
A steroid hormone released by the corpus luteum that prepares the endometrium for the implantation of a fertilized egg and maintains pregnancy.
Mating Preferences
The criteria by which individuals select partners for reproduction, influenced by biological, psychological, and social factors.
Evolutionary Accounts
Theories or explanations that describe how biological traits or behaviors have developed over time through the process of natural selection.
